Subject: Quickstore 4.2 — bloom filter now fronts the KV layer

Plugin authors: starting with this release, Quickstore places a bloom filter ahead of the key-value store. Negative lookups return faster; false positives fall through safely. No API changes are required on your side. Verify your plugin against the staging build referenced below.

session token of fahif-tadup = htk3_9c7

Handover Note — Insurance Renewal

From the outgoing director to the finance team: the group policy with Quillane Mutual renews at the end of the quarter. Premiums are up roughly eight percent; the broker has flagged the Darnell warehouse valuation as the main driver. Renewal papers are in the shared binder and need sign-off within three weeks. The renewal decision ties into the plans noted below.

management briefing: Jorixax Holdings is in early talks to buy Casixax Holdings for about $420.3 million. The Fenmir launch date is October 27, and nothing goes to the press before then. Legal wants the Keloxek Foods term sheet redrafted before April 16.

**Finance Review Summary — Project Ashgrove**

Project Ashgrove, the internal billing-platform migration, is now eight weeks behind schedule. Costs to date stand at 112% of the phase-two budget, driven chiefly by extended contractor engagements and a rework of the reconciliation module. We recommend the board approve a revised completion date and a contingency release of up to 7%. The wider commercial considerations informing this recommendation are set out below.

board note of baweg-bawig: Project Tamath slips by six weeks because of the audit delay.

**Vendor note: Inkmill markdown pipeline**

Rendering for Parchway docs is outsourced to Inkmill under an annual contract, renewing each March. They handle sanitization and PDF export; we own the upload queue. SLA: 4-hour response on rendering failures. Escalate only after two failed retries. Their support desk is reachable at the address below.

billing contact of hahaf-baguf = zorael.tammir.jorius@sivrelhq.internal